On Mon, Nov 07, 2005 at 07:40:44PM -0800, Randy.Dunlap wrote:
> Just to be clear about the usage, the kernel-doc script switches from
> public to private upon seeing a /*-style comment with the strings
> "private:" or "public:" in it.  Right?

exactly.

For now I only changed those comments that already made it clear
what was private and public.  Feel free to add more private fields! :-)
